Ingredients
- Chicken & Salad: 2 cups cooked chicken breast, diced or shredded, 1/2 cup celery, finely chopped, 1/2 cup red grapes, halved, 1/4 cup dried cranberries, 1/4 cup toasted pecans or walnuts, roughly chopped, 2 spring onions, thinly sliced
- Dressing: 1/3 cup mayonnaise, 2 tablespoons Greek yogurt, 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ard, 1 teaspoon honey, 1 tablespoon lemon juice, Salt and pepper, to taste
- For Serving: 6 large lettuce leaves (e.g. butter lettuce or romaine), Fresh parsley or dill, chopped (optional, for garnish)
Instructions
- Step 1:
- In a large bowl, combine the chicken, celery, grapes, cranberries, nuts, and spring onions.
- Step 2:
- In a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, Greek yogurt, Dijon mustard, honey, lemon juice, salt, and pepper until smooth.
- Step 3:
- Pour the dressing over the chicken mixture and toss gently to coat evenly.
- Step 4:
-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
- Step 5:
- Spoon the chicken salad evenly into the lettuce leaves to form individual cups.
- Step 6:
- Garnish with fresh parsley or dill, if desired. Serve immediately.

Allergen Information
Contains eggs (mayonnaise), tree nuts (pecans or walnuts), and dairy (Greek yogurt). For nut-free or dairy-free versions, substitute accordingly and check all labels for allergens.

Recipe FAQs
- → What type of chicken is best for this dish?
Cooked chicken breast, either diced or shredded, works best for a tender texture.
- → Can I substitute nuts for seeds?
Yes, toasted seeds can replace nuts to accommodate nut-free preferences without compromising crunch.
- → What greens are recommended for the cups?
Butter lettuce or romaine leaves provide a crisp and sturdy base for the filling.
- → How can I add extra flavor to the dressing?
A pinch of curry powder or smoked paprika enhances the dressing with subtle spice and depth.
- → Is it possible to make this dish dairy-free?
Substitute Greek yogurt with a dairy-free alternative and check other ingredients for allergens accordingly.
